Im pretty new here and Im sure theres other posts for this error. Ive been looking all over to solve this issue and nothing has worked so far and I dont know what to do anymore. So Im very greatfull for any help you could give me.

I get this error for several programs like AVG and Windows Live Mail. I tried installing the C++ Redistributable 2005, 2005 SP1, 2008, 2008 SP1, 2010, 2010 SP1 but that didnt help. I also tried the command sfc/scannow but that turned up nothing. I tried running sxstrace.exe but it just comes up for like half a second and then disappears into the background. I then had a look in the event log but to be honest I have no idea what Im looking at or what I should even look for so I will just paste the log for AVG here and hopefully someone can help.

By the way I have a HP Pavillion Laptop with Windows 7 Home Premium 64bit. Not sure what other information would be helpful.

Uninstall AVG it just loves to block the newer windows features for no apparent reason.
MSE is free and not perfect either but at least it doesn't have any known issues.
Virus, Spyware & Malware Protection | Microsoft Security Essentials
occasional side by side errors in the management console are practically normal, but they shouldn't be interfering with your use.

Side by side errors can also be caused by .net framework problems, so you can look into installing/reinstalling the .net framework stuff.
